Transaction 3d70e2e7e23d76f5725ce773bdd8394c16c3543b366a7e9be72fbf6998ae4921
1 Input
2 Outputs
- 3d70e2e7e23d76f5725ce773bdd8394c16c3543b366a7e9be72fbf6998ae4921:0
- 3d70e2e7e23d76f5725ce773bdd8394c16c3543b366a7e9be72fbf6998ae4921:1
value 6637
address 12HoGScBC8gsxXguxTHhmsfQ9uQ8Proai9
value 502405
address 1ME5xwbgYQuDHTxCFL134iPhAVYkHCgT7n